3. To Win Now, CREATE A LOVEMARK

Today everything is a brand, nothing is a brand. To win, you have to engage the primary human drive.

Brands are owned by companies, marketers, and stockholders. Lovemarks are owned by the people who love them.

  • Brands are built on Respect. Lovemarks are created out of Respect and Love.
  • Brands build Loyalty for a Reason. Lovemarks inspire Loyalty Beyond Reason.
  • Brands deliver performance, respect and trust. Lovemarks infuse Mystery, Sensuality and Intimacy, the stuff that matters.
  • Mystery: Danish futurist Rolf Jensen: “The highest-paid person in the first half of this century will be the story-teller.”
  • Sensuality: Android 4.0 is called Ice Cream Sandwich – it’s a pretty tasty treat. Rio de Janeiro is the city of sensuality.
  • Intimacy: NZ as investor paradise: In The WEF Executive Opinion Survey, 2011-2012, NZ was the No.1 country in anti-corruption, anti-bribery, independence of judiciary and investor protection.
  • Brands aim to be Irreplaceable. Lovemarks are Irresistible.

5. To Win Now, MAKE IT A HABIT 

Winning is a habit. Unfortunately so is losing.

Winning fast and forever is about Peak Flow and Cool Tools.

Peak Flow
Winning is habit-forming ‘in the zone’, operating at Peak Flow day in day out, not just in times of crisis and not just at quarter end, for Peak Performance.

Flow comes from Inspirational Players focused on purpose-driving activities. This is radical optimism at work.

Flow puts people in the zone all the time. With more time in flow, organizations can:

  • Get beyond command and control
  • Deal with complexity
  • Build close relationships with partners
  • Have better ideas
  • Keep getting faster

Flow is Toyota-lean, Steve Jobs-lean, DarWIN lean. All systems and activities focus on creating customer value and delivering the Dream.

Flow combines passion and harmony, enabled by wellbeing, happiness through fulfilling true potential (signature strengths, reframing, personal purpose).

Passion is emotional connection with the Dream. It’s crazed want to win that knows no failure.

  • Dan Dennett said the secret of happiness is to find something bigger than yourself and then devote your life to it.
  • Winston Churchill. “Success is the ability to go from one failure to another with no loss of enthusiasm.”

Harmony of individual and shared consciousness enables instantaneous decision making and delivery. It’s about:

  • Intuitive, instinctive, trusting relationships
  • Fluid flexible organization design
  • Rapid transparent communication
  • Open dialogue / regular feedback.

There are lots of Tools to Flow faster. Five:

  • 100 Day Plans; start with verb, add noun, ignite. From small to Big: “sell 1000 units”’ to “Achieve Middle-East Peace.”
  • Drive the important not the urgent. Goizueta: Meet, Beat, Repeat. KR: respond right now.
  • Fail Fast, Learn Fast, Fix Fast. P&G’s Marc Pritchard talks about ‘do-learn’ brand building – doing and learning simultaneously.
  • Blue Ocean: Eliminate – Reduce – Raise – Create. Eliminate is key.
  • De Bono: there’s no point at being brilliant at the wrong thing.

ADE: Assess, Decide, Execute.

From To
Assess 50% 20%
Decide 30% 10%
Execute 20% 70%
